21 | /** | ||
22 | * @file src/util/getopt_helpers.c | ||
23 | * @brief implements command line that sets option | ||
24 | * @author Christian Grothoff | ||
25 | */ | ||
26 | |||
27 | #include "platform.h" | ||
28 | #include "gnunet_common.h" | ||
29 | #include "gnunet_getopt_lib.h" | ||
30 | |||
31 | |||
32 | int | ||
33 | GNUNET_GETOPT_print_version_ (struct GNUNET_GETOPT_CommandLineProcessorContext | ||
34 | *ctx, void *scls, const char *option, | ||
35 | const char *value) | ||
36 | { | ||
37 | const char *version = scls; | ||
38 | |||
39 | printf ("%s v%s\n", ctx->binaryName, version); | ||
40 | return GNUNET_SYSERR; | ||
41 | } | ||
42 | |||
43 | |||
44 | |||
45 | #define BORDER 29 | ||
46 | |||
47 | int | ||
48 | GNUNET_GETOPT_format_help_ (struct GNUNET_GETOPT_CommandLineProcessorContext | ||
49 | *ctx, void *scls, const char *option, | ||
50 | const char *value) | ||
51 | { | ||
52 | const char *about = scls; | ||
53 | int slen; | ||
54 | int i; | ||
55 | int j; | ||
56 | int ml; | ||
57 | int p; | ||
58 | char *scp; | ||
59 | const char *trans; | ||
60 | const struct GNUNET_GETOPT_CommandLineOption *opt; | ||
61 | |||
62 | printf ("%s\n%s\n", ctx->binaryOptions, gettext (about)); | ||
63 | printf (_ | ||
64 | ("Arguments mandatory for long options are also mandatory for short options.\n")); | ||
65 | slen = 0; | ||
66 | i = 0; | ||
67 | opt = ctx->allOptions; | ||
68 | while (opt[i].description != NULL) | ||
69 | { | ||
70 | if (opt[i].shortName == '\0') | ||
71 | printf (" "); | ||
72 | else | ||
73 | printf (" -%c, ", opt[i].shortName); | ||
74 | printf ("--%s", opt[i].name); | ||
75 | slen = 8 + strlen (opt[i].name); | ||
76 | if (opt[i].argumentHelp != NULL) | ||
77 | { | ||
78 | printf ("=%s", opt[i].argumentHelp); | ||
79 | slen += 1 + strlen (opt[i].argumentHelp); | ||
80 | } | ||
81 | if (slen > BORDER) | ||
82 | { | ||
83 | printf ("\n%*s", BORDER, ""); | ||
84 | slen = BORDER; | ||
85 | } | ||
86 | if (slen < BORDER) | ||
87 | { | ||
88 | printf ("%*s", BORDER - slen, ""); | ||
89 | slen = BORDER; | ||
90 | } | ||
91 | trans = gettext (opt[i].description); | ||
92 | ml = strlen (trans); | ||
93 | p = 0; | ||
94 | OUTER: | ||
95 | while (ml - p > 78 - slen) | ||
96 | { | ||
97 | for (j = p + 78 - slen; j > p; j--) | ||
98 | { | ||
99 | if (isspace (trans[j])) | ||
100 | { | ||
101 | scp = GNUNET_malloc (j - p + 1); | ||
102 | memcpy (scp, &trans[p], j - p); | ||
103 | scp[j - p] = '\0'; | ||
104 | printf ("%s\n%*s", scp, BORDER + 2, ""); | ||
105 | GNUNET_free (scp); | ||
106 | p = j + 1; | ||
107 | slen = BORDER + 2; | ||
108 | goto OUTER; | ||
109 | } | ||
110 | } | ||
111 | /* could not find space to break line */ | ||
112 | scp = GNUNET_malloc (78 - slen + 1); | ||
113 | memcpy (scp, &trans[p], 78 - slen); | ||
114 | scp[78 - slen] = '\0'; | ||
115 | printf ("%s\n%*s", scp, BORDER + 2, ""); | ||
116 | GNUNET_free (scp); | ||
117 | slen = BORDER + 2; | ||
118 | p = p + 78 - slen; | ||
119 | } | ||
120 | /* print rest */ | ||
121 | if (p < ml) | ||
122 | printf ("%s\n", &trans[p]); | ||
123 | if (strlen (trans) == 0) | ||
124 | printf ("\n"); | ||
125 | i++; | ||
126 | } | ||
127 | printf ("Report bugs to gnunet-developers@gnu.org.\n" | ||
128 | "GNUnet home page: http://www.gnu.org/software/gnunet/\n" | ||
129 | "General help using GNU software: http://www.gnu.org/gethelp/\n"); | ||
130 | return GNUNET_SYSERR; | ||
131 | } | ||
